Since 1978, Gillece Services has served the Pittsburgh area as a family-owned and operated provider of residential plumbing, HVAC, and electrical solutions — covering emergency calls, upkeep, fixes, and system swaps. Gillece covers seven counties across Western Pennsylvania and operate year-round, 365 days a year. You can contact us for emergency service or schedule weekend calls to fit your needs.
